The child walking up out of the BART station slightly behind his mother marched on the sidewalk for about five steps, continuing the motion involved in walking upstairs.

Then he skipped for a few steps.

Then he walked the shape of two curves back and forth like an elongated S

Then he started walking as most adults walk, pacing a straight line down the sidewalk.

All in about ninety seconds.
